Robert Friedrich
Robert Friedrich was a Conservative candidate for District 24 of the New York State Assembly. The primary election was on September 14, 2010, and the general election was on November 2.

After losing to David Weprin in the Democratic primary, Friedrich secured a place on the ballot as a Conservative party candidate. Friedrich was defeated by incumbent David Weprin (D) in the general election on November 2.[1]
